Sport Central is a multi-purpose built sports centre and events arena that is located in the centre of Newcastle upon Tyne, England. It forms part of the Northumbria University campus, in the city centre.[1] The centre houses facilities for swimming, track running, climbing, golf, squash, basketball, netball, badminton, and volleyball.[2] The main sports and events arena has a capacity for over 2,800 spectators.

History[]

Sport Central opened in 2010, at a cost of £30 million.[3] It was previously the home venue of British Basketball League team Newcastle Eagles, and Netball Superleague side Team Northumbria.[4] The arena has also hosted international basketball, when the senior men's Great Britain national team staged a game there, featuring NBA star Luol Deng.[5]
